cmake_modules/CheckHaskellModuleExists.cmake
branchqmlfrontend
changeset 11403 b894922d58cc
parent 11338 facac91c7c65
child 11855 ad435d95ca4b
equal deleted inserted replaced
11076:fcbdee9cdd74 11403:b894922d58cc
     9 # See the License for more information.
     9 # See the License for more information.
    10 #=============================================================================
    10 #=============================================================================
    11 
    11 
    12 macro(CHECK_HASKELL_MODULE_EXISTS MODULE FUNCTION PARAMCOUNT LIBRARY)
    12 macro(CHECK_HASKELL_MODULE_EXISTS MODULE FUNCTION PARAMCOUNT LIBRARY)
    13   set(VARIABLE "HS_MODULE_${LIBRARY}_${FUNCTION}")
    13   set(VARIABLE "HS_MODULE_${LIBRARY}_${FUNCTION}")
    14   if("${VARIABLE}" MATCHES "^${VARIABLE}$")
    14   if(${VARIABLE} MATCHES ^${VARIABLE}$)
    15     message(STATUS "Looking for ${FUNCTION} in ${MODULE}")
    15     message(STATUS "Looking for ${FUNCTION} in ${MODULE}")
    16 
    16 
    17     set(PARAMETERS "")
    17     set(PARAMETERS "")
    18 
    18 
    19     if(PARAMCOUNT GREATER 0)
    19     if(PARAMCOUNT GREATER 0)